HIGH PERFORMANCE BUILDING ALLIANCE (HPBA)

The High Performance Building Alliance recently established a Centre of Excellence which aims to promote a climate change approach to the built environment. 

Ireland has been leading the way on legislation for high performance buildings and Wexford has been to the forefront in the advancement of the energy performance buildings as a key strategy with funding support from Wexford County Council and the Waterford and Wexford Education and Training Board. Ultimately warmer buildings mean better homes, address fuel poverty, reduce the carbon footprint and support job creation.

The HPBA supported by Wexford County Council and Enterprise Ireland is seeking a Business Development Manager to develop a Green Hub in Enniscorthy Technology Park.  The Hub will develop a pipeline of enterprises that will feed in collaboration with industry in fostering an entrepreneurship culture and provide support to inform the work of the hub as a commercial platform targeting marketing opportunities that will enable growth and scale. The green hub will provide an incubation workspace, designed to stimulate collaborative thinking with event and meeting space in a unique setting for new start-ups and business expansion SMEs with a focus on emerging green opportunities.  Tackling emissions is good for our planet, economy, business and community.  In particular the Green Hub as a one stop shop will support businesses in; 
•    Research, development and innovation
•    Sustainability 
•    Supply side opportunities
•    Quality training, business advice mentoring
•    Funding supports 
•    Digitalisation
•    Export/internationalisation 
•    Networks and clustering

The Business Development Manager will work to advance entrepreneurship, innovation and sustainable solutions through collaboration with local government, public agencies, industry, education and training stakeholders and social partners.
